In a graphic image, the x and y denote width and height; the … WebMar 22, 2024 · y axis makes an angle 90 with x axis, 0 with y axis & 90 with z axis. So, = 90 , = 0 , = 90 Direction cosines are l = cos 90 , m = cos 0 , n = cos 90 l = 0 , m = 1, n = 0 Direction cosines of y axis are 0, 1, 0.

WebTranslations in context of "x-, y- and z-direction are" in English-German from Reverso Context: The movements of the transport media within the warehouse in x-, y- and z … WebIf a line makes angles 90 ∘,135 ∘,45 ∘ with the x,y and Z−axes respectively, find its direction cosines. Easy Solution Verified by Toppr Let the direction cosines of the line be l,m,n. l=cos90 o=0 m=cos135 o=− 21 n=cos45 o= 21 Therefore, the direction cosines of the line are 0,− 21 and 21.
